Watch: Lampard hails Coleman as Everton confirm survival from relegation

written by Staff Writer May 21, 2022
FacebookTweetLinkedInPrint

Frank Lampard singled out Everton captain Seamus Coleman as Everton avoided relegation on the second last day of the Premier League season.

A viral video of the dressing room after Everton came from 2-0 down against Crystal Palace to win 3-2 and confirm top flight football for another season for the struggling Merseyside club sees manager Frank Lampard heap praise on the Killybegs man.

Lampard singles out the Everton captain and says: “This fella is one of the best people I’ve ever met.”

The former Chelsea midfielder took over mid season while Everton were struggling in a relegation battle but the video shows he has the backing from the players.

Lampard also heaps praise on goalscoring hero Richarlison who has bagged six goals in his last eight game for The Toffees.

The dressing room then descends into party mode as the Brazilian celebrates their win and survival.
